Diver struck by boat propeller meets firefighters who helped rescue him
After a successful afternoon of spearfishing in Fort Lauderdale, David Labrador surfaced. But he saw a boat moving directly toward his head and dived back underwater. Not quickly enough. The boat’s propeller struck his upper left thigh and his rear end, leaving two deep lacerations that were 12 inches and 8 inches long. “I just kept saying, ‘Save my leg, save my leg,’” Labrador said.
